💊 1. Over-the-counter medications
Pain relievers, cold remedies, antacids, and other self-service medications are frequently targeted. Easy to access and small in size, they can be concealed instantly.

🪥 2. Oral hygiene products
Electric toothbrushes, whitening kits, or branded toothpaste are frequent targets. Their higher prices make them attractive to opportunistic thieves.

🧴 3. Cosmetics and beauty products
Facial creams, anti-aging serums, high-end makeup… These products combine small size with high value, an ideal combination for theft.

🚼 4. Baby products
Infant formula, diapers, and wipes are also regularly targeted.

🧼 5. Premium body care
Essential oils, organic lotions, or dermatological creams are often stolen in urban pharmacies. Their placement on accessible shelves makes them easy to grab.

🧠 6. Dietary supplements
Vitamins, fat burners, weight-loss and sleep aids are among the most popular—and most stolen—products.
